CapnScurvy 03-26-10 11:46 AM

Well it looks like I should get off my butt and make a SCAF 1.9 compatible edition!!

Thanks Nbjackso for keeping up with SCAF.

I'm away from home right now, but I'll see what I can do to make a compatible edition soon. To be accurate, I'll have to recheck each ship for calibrated accuracy of its reference point height (I just don't assume the ship's heights are not changed from one version of a mod to another. It's too easy to change how the ship sits in the water to not check what every mod thinks is correct, thus changing the height of the reference point). New ships always need to be checked.
